Description Stanislas RENAN 2010-09-29 12:50:00 UTC
The definition of "size" parameter is ambiguous.

It is defined as :
"Log files are rotated when they grow bigger then size bytes."

It appears the the behaviour is :
"Log files are rotated only if they grow bigger then size bytes."


First definition does not mean that if the file size is below _size_ bytes, it won't be rotated.
Second definition means that if the file size is below _size_ bytes, it won't be rotated.

I find the second definition less confusing and closer to the actual behaviour of logrotate.

I think that the "minsize" parameter may also benefit from a disambiguation.
